i agree, image ready is the quickest way to go about doing that, call up your image and look at it in 4-up mode which will show you the levels of compression and how that effects the image. Also 70 images shouldn't be hard to fit into 10 megs.

who is your audience? most people run 1024x768 displays

so a 400 x 400 pixel image will seem to fill a sizeable chunk of the screen.

check to see that your image isn't something crazy like 1600x1200 at 72 dpi

you don't need all the info when posting on the web.
